Scope of Position

The Director, Talent Management role represents a dynamic opportunity for a professional with strong interpersonal, organizational, analytical and leadership skills to work as a key member of the Talent Management team. Reporting to the Vice President, Talent Management & Learning and collaborating with members of the global HR team, the Director, Talent Management will be a thought partner and valued member of the team by building and enhancing the function. This role will have 1-2 direct reports and be based out of North Andover, MA.

Primary Job Duties and Responsibilities

Core Responsibilities

  • Partner with the VP Talent Management & Learning to set a multi-year global Talent Management strategy
  • Collaborate with global HR to implement the global Talent Management roadmap and initiatives
  • Develop and gain leadership buy-in for the programs to engage, develop, and retain Top / Critical talent
  • Continue to evolve Watts's organizational effectiveness programs and advance our community of highly engaged talent across the enterprise

Performance Management

  • Oversee the continued roll out of a consistent global performance management process that focuses employee's efforts on the achievement of business goals and attainment of requisite skills / competencies
  • Design and implement accountability tools for performance management process that raises the bar on performance expectations and manager capabilities
  • Talent Review / Succession Planning

  • Partner with leaders and global HR to implement the Strategic Talent Review process focusing on both, the identification of top / critical talent and targeted development opportunities for them
  • Develop and administer a succession process which focuses on building bench strength to meet current and future business needs
  • Develop, implement, and evaluate succession management tools and strategies to increase Watts's capacity to make effective talent decisions and maintain healthy talent pipelines
  • Drive best practices in succession planning and partner with global HR to ensure that a diverse bench of talent is identified and developed to meet organizational needs
  • Conduct individual leadership, career and talent assessments as appropriate using a variety of tools
  • Accelerate the readiness of our talent to achieve the enterprise strategy
  • Develop a formal approach for mobility, focused on giving our talent opportunities to make intentional moves across the enterprise closing succession gaps and / or promoting development
  • Partner with Talent team and global HR to reduce barriers and institute programs and tools to promote internal mobility
  • Organizational Leadership

  • Form collaborative relationships with global HR to execute talent strategies and efforts to support the growth / strategic objectives of the company
  • Research latest development in management, leadership and organization development areas and keep abreast to serve as a subject matter expert and consult to organization regarding critical people topics
  • Partner with HRIS team for talent-related technology implementations (i.e., Workday)
  • Establish and analyze talent metrics and qualitative information to measure and report on effectiveness
  • Lead other Talent Management initiatives as needed
  • Required Qualifications

    Bachelor's degree in Human Resources or Business Management or similar. 10+ years of experience in Talent Management / Organizational Development. Experience in multiple Human Resources disciplines, including HR Business Partner, Talent Management, Organizational Development and Change Management. Proven ability to translate business strategies into organizational initiatives. Demonstrated ability to implement Talent Management initiatives and programs across the organization to management and staff at all levels. Proven ability to conceptualize, design, lead, implement, and monitor broad HR-related programs and initiatives in the context of broader business / organizational objectives. Experience working with global teams within a manufacturing industry. Strong skills and experience in managing talent initiatives, internal consulting and organization development interventions. Project management skills, analytical skills, organization skills, and strong time management skills. Strong written and verbal communication skills. Highly collaborative with an ability to work across multiple organization levels, geographies and partner with cross-functional teams. Able to work in a fast paced, dynamic environment and demonstrate a sense of urgency. Stays current with trends, research and best practices in Talent Management / Organizational Development. Travel required : 15%

    Preferred Qualifications

    Master's degree in business and / or Human Resources Management / Organizational Development is preferred.
